How to fill out engineered grading inspection report

How to fill out Engineered Grading Inspection Report
01
Gather all necessary project documentation.
02
Review the grading plans and specifications provided by the engineer.
03
Inspect the site to ensure all grading work complies with the approved plans.
04
Document all observations during the inspection process.
05
Record any discrepancies or issues found in the report.
06
Include photographs of the site and any specific areas of concern.
07
Fill out the required sections of the Engineered Grading Inspection Report, including date, location, and inspector information.
08
Provide clear and detailed descriptions of the grading work completed.
09
Sign and date the report upon completion.
10
Submit the report to the relevant authorities or project stakeholders.

What is Engineered Grading Inspection Report?
An Engineered Grading Inspection Report is a document that details the findings and compliance of grading activities performed on a construction site, ensuring that the work meets engineering specifications and regulations.
Who is required to file Engineered Grading Inspection Report?
Typically, licensed civil engineers or grading contractors who performed the grading work are required to file the Engineered Grading Inspection Report.
How to fill out Engineered Grading Inspection Report?
To fill out the Engineered Grading Inspection Report, provide detailed information regarding the grading work done, including site specifics, measurements, materials used, and signatures of the inspecting engineer confirming the work meets all required standards.
What is the purpose of Engineered Grading Inspection Report?
The purpose of the Engineered Grading Inspection Report is to document the compliance of grading work with design specifications and local regulations, ensuring safety and proper land use.
What information must be reported on Engineered Grading Inspection Report?
The report must include the project name, location, description of the grading performed, dates of work, names of inspectors and engineers involved, results of inspections, and any deviations from approved plans.
